Ingredients for Strawberry Cheesecake Dip
- 16 oz (2 blocks) c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up strawberry jam (or strawberry preserves)
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
How to Make Slow Cooker Strawberry Cheesecake Dip
Step 1: Prepare the Crockpot
Lightly grease a 2–4 quart slow cooker with butter or nonstick spray.
Step 2: Add Cream Cheese
Cut softened cream cheese into chunks and place in the slow cooker for even melting.
Step 3: Add Remaining Ingredients
Spoon in the strawberry jam. Add sour cream and sugar on top.
Step 4: Stir to Combine
Gently stir ingredients together. It doesn’t need to be completely smooth yet.
Step 5: Cook on LOW
Cover and cook on LOW for 1½ to 2 hours. Stir every 30 minutes until smooth, creamy, and fully melted.
Step 6: Adjust Flavor
Taste and add more jam or sugar if desired.
Step 7: Serve Warm
Switch to WARM setting and serve with your favorite dippers.
Best Dippers for Cheesecake Dip
- Graham crackers
- Vanilla wafers
- Shortbread cookies
- Sugar cookies
- Apple slices
- Fresh strawberries
- Pear slices
- Pretzels (for sweet & salty flavor)
Recipe Variations & Tips
- ✔ Swap half the sour cream for Greek yogurt for a lighter cheesecake flavor.
- ✔ Add 1 teaspoon vanilla extract for extra depth.
- ✔ Swirl ¼ cup extra strawberry jam on top for a marbled look.
- ✔ Use raspberry, cherry, or mixed berry jam for different flavors.
- ✔ Sprinkle crushed graham crackers on top for a cheesecake crust texture.
- ✔ Store leftovers in the refrigerator and reheat with a splash of milk or cream.
Make-Ahead Instructions
Combine all ingredients in the slow cooker insert, refrigerate overnight, then cook the next day as directed. This makes it a perfect holiday dessert dip or easy entertaining recipe.
